Critical Role of Medical Device Sterilization

Infection control remains a key element of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Effective sterilization of medical devices substantially re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ers both. Poor sterilization can bring about outbreaks of dangerous di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Sterilization Techniques for Medical Devices

The science behind sterilization has grown considerably over the last century, using a variety of methods suited to different types of devices and materials. Some of the most predominantly chosen techniques include:

Steam Autoclaving

Autoclaving remains the most standard and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is speedy, inexpensive, and eco-conscious,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Emerging Developments in Medical Device Sterilization

As medicine evolves, several key trends are impacting medical device sterilization:

Eco-Conscious Sterilization Approaches

As sustainability standards heighten, companies are actively investing in eco-responsible sterilization methods. Strategies include lowering reliance on unsafe ch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ring environmentally safe packaging options, and optimizing power use in sterilization operations.

Complex Materials and Device Complexity

The expansion of high-tech med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ization systems capable of handling delicate materials. Improvements in sterilization include methods particularly low-temperature plasma his comment is here s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ging complex components.

Advanced Digital Traceability

With advances in digital technology, traceability of sterilization protocols is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er in-depth docum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time notifications, significantly minimizing human error and improving patient safety.
